Péché Mignon is the result of years spent working in kitchens, learning, experimenting, and growing a deep appreciation for the craft of pastry.
Chef Sappir’s love for baking started early—rooted in family, tradition, and the comfort of being in the kitchen. Over time, that early passion turned into a serious commitment to the art and precision of pastry.
Her inspiration comes from a mix of cultures and places—drawing from her heritage, the flavors she grew up with, and experiences from her travels. While she trained professionally in France and spent time in Michelin-starred kitchens, it’s the combination of lived experience, curiosity, and personal taste that shape Péché Mignon.
